I'm with you: it's not strong winds that effect the canopy it's increased turbulence and a general increase in wind activity. The canopy knows nothing of windspeed, only airspeed - how else does its groundspeed vary according to whether you're running or holding? Gus OutpatientsOnline.com

Have you ever gone low unintentionally?
gus replied to jerry81's topic in General Skydiving Discussions
Mine was my second camera jump, around my 250th in total. I had a new helmet for my camera, my audible wasn't sat quite right so I didn't hear it and I was so focused on filming that I lost all awareness until I saw someone else look at their altimeter. Was under my main by ~1500. Gus OutpatientsOnline.com -
